How much can a freeze dryer reduce the moisture in the compressed air

The freeze dryer can reduce the moisture content in the compressed air to a relative humidity of below 35%, and the corresponding pressure dew point temperature is about 2-10℃. This performance indicator can meet the requirements for compressed air dryness in most industrial scenarios, but the specific effect will be affected by the following factors:

1. Working principle of equipment
The freeze dryer cools the compressed air to below the dew point temperature through the refrigeration system, so that the water vapor in the air condenses into liquid water, which is then discharged through the gas-water separator. Its core components include precooler, evaporator, and gas-water separator, which realize continuous water removal through the principle of heat exchange.

2. key performance indicators

  • pressure dew point: A parameter reflecting the dryness of compressed air. The lower the value, the drier the air. Freeze dryers usually control the dew point pressure in the range of 2-10 ° C.
  • throughputThe nominal rated capacity of the equipment shall match the gas production of the air compressor, otherwise the water removal effect will be affected.

3. Factors affecting water removal efficiency

  • ambient temperature: High temperature environments will reduce refrigeration efficiency and lead to an increase in pressure dew point.
  • inlet air temperature: The high-temperature air discharged by the air compressor needs to be cooled by the precooler first. The higher the inlet temperature, the greater the water removal load.
  • working pressure: Pressure fluctuations will affect water vapor saturation, so system pressure needs to be kept stable.

4. Practical application recommendations

  • Conventional industrial scenarios: For example, machining, pneumatic tools, etc., the pressure dew point ≤10℃ can meet the demand.
  • Precision manufacturing field: For the production of electronic components, it is recommended to configure a twin-tower freeze dryer to stabilize the pressure dew point at 3-5℃.
  • Extreme environmental response: In high temperature and humidity areas, pre-coolers can be installed or models with increased cooling capacity can be used.

5. Explanation of limitations
Freeze dryers cannot achieve absolute water-free, and their lowest pressure dew point is limited by the boiling point of the refrigerant. If you need to reach a dew point below-40℃, you need to switch to an adsorption dryer. For gas use scenarios that directly contact the product, it is recommended to install a precision filter at the back end to remove residual liquid water and oil mist.
